Overview
The Nomad 3 earned a reputation as the go-to desktop mill for precision work in wood, plastic, and non-ferrous metals. The Nomad 4 keeps that promise and raises the bar with dramatically more performance.
A 1.2 kW VFD spindle replaces the previous 130 W motor, delivering far higher material removal rates and the headroom to run demanding speeds and feeds without stalling. Ballscrews on every axis replace traditional leadscrews, improving efficiency and stiffness where it matters most: under load. Combine that with HG-series linear rails on all three axes — not just Z — and you get a motion system rigid enough to fully support the spindle’s power.
The result is a machine that works fast and stays accurate: faster cycle times, cleaner cuts, and the confidence to run parts you’d otherwise second-guess.
The 10" × 8" × 3.5" cutting envelope gives you more room to work, and the table comes standard with a threaded hole pattern for workholding. No additional accessories are required to start fixturing parts, jigs, and clamps right away.
Larger windows improve visibility during jobs, while a new door design makes access easier in confined spaces.

What's New in the Nomad 4
1.2 kW VFD Spindle with ER16 Collet System Nearly 10× the spindle power of the Nomad 3, plus a wider collet selection for more tooling options. Higher material removal rates, better surface finish at speed, and the headroom to use larger endmills.
16 mm Ballscrews on Every Axis More efficient power transfer from motor to table, with greater rigidity under load. Less deflection means tighter tolerances and more repeatable results, especially on longer jobs.
NEMA 23 Motors Upgraded from NEMA 17 motors across the board. More torque means the motion system can keep pace with the spindle. The system also runs on 36 V instead of 24 V, providing an additional torque advantage.
Industrial-Grade Motion System HG-series linear rails on all three axes replace the round-rod system on the Nomad 3. Stiffer, more precise, and built to handle the demands of a more powerful machine. Additionally, the linear rails are back-mounted, which presents a seamless face that helps keep dust and debris out of the bearings.
Robust Aluminum Chassis Nomad 4 also features a structure with billet aluminum components — no extrusions, no compromises.
Expanded 10" × 8" × 3.5" Cutting Area More room for larger parts, bigger fixtures, and more ambitious setups.
Threaded Table Standard The Nomad 4 ships with a built-in threaded table with a 25 x 25 mm hole pattern for workholding. Bolt down your vise, clamps, or custom fixtures with no additional accessories required.
External Electronics The machine controller and VFD are housed in an external unit that can be located separately from the machine. This keeps the electronics cooler and cleaner, while improving serviceability.
Power Pendant The included Power Pendant allows you to halt the machine for any reason. It can be placed anywhere on your workbench, and is connected to the controller with a 2-meter tether.
Dust Collection (Optional) A dust collection attachment allows you to use the 65 mm Sweepy V2, and route the hose out of the machine without any modifications to the enclosure.

Nomad 4 Specifications
Materials to Cut Wood All types of wood Plastic Most plastics, including: ABS, Acrylic, Polycarbonate, Delrin, HDPE, PEEK, PVC Metals Aluminum, Brass, Copper (Some alloys are more suitable for machining) Machine Specs Ballscrew X/Y 16 mm diameter, 10 mm pitch Ballscrew Z 16 mm diameter, 5 mm pitch Ballscrew Accuracy +/- 0.002" per foot Step Length X/Y 0.00025" Step Length Z 0.00012" Total Z Travel 3.75" Clearance (under Z-axis) 4" Linear Rails HG-15, back-mounted Homing Switches Inductive sensors Size Cutting Area 10"(X) x 8"(Y) x 3.5"(Z) Footprint 18" (X), 18.1" (Y), 20.5" (Z*) Weight 120 lb (approx.) Shipment Size 30 x 30" Pallet, 160 lb (approx.) Spindle Spindle Power 1200 Watt VFD Motor Spindle Collet ER-16 (1/8", 1/4", and 3/8" collets included) Spindle RPM 8000 - 24000 RPM Electrical Specifications Input Voltage 110 V (50/60 Hz, non-GFCI) Max Current 12 A AC Cable IEC C13 to NEMA 5-15P (Standard US plug) Computer Requirements Mac OS/X 13 or higher (Apple Silicon) Windows Windows 10 or 11, 64-bit (Intel or AMD) -

Software Included
Carbide Create - Our 2D CAD/CAM program, designed specifically for Carbide 3D machines. Free to use with any of our CNC machines, and available to download right now.
Carbide Motion - The machine controller software for all Carbide 3D machines. Free to use, with no license or internet connection required.
MeshCAM - Nomad 4 includes MeshCAM V8, making it easy to generate G-code from STL files without additional CAM software. MeshCAM saves a proprietary G-code file for the Nomad, so no additional license code is required to use it with the Nomad 4. It will not generate G-code for other machines.
Alibre Workshop - Nomad 4 includes a code that can be redeemed for an Alibre Workshop license. The license is granted to the person who redeems it and is non-transferable. Contact us if you have any questions.
